What the numbers show

Health risks - Regions — Circulatory system diseases mortality crude rate is currently reported for 41 countries. The highest value is 948.55 Per 100 000 inhabitants in Bulgaria; the lowest is 45 Per 100 000 inhabitants in Costa Rica.

The median across all reporting countries is 251.61 Per 100 000 inhabitants, and the mean is 337.32 Per 100 000 inhabitants.

The gap between the highest and lowest reporting country is a factor of about 21.

Over the past decade 6 countries rose and 35 fell. The largest increase was in Colombia (up 44.5%), and the largest decrease in Costa Rica (down 78.3%).

This dataset provides indicators on health risks in large regions (TL2), and small regions (TL3) when data is available. Indicators include obesity rates, air pollution exposure, mortality rates due to circulatory and respiratory diseases. Data definition and source Obesity rate is the percentage of population 15 years old or more with a BMI>30 kg/m2. The Body Mass Index (BMI) is a single number that evaluates an individual's weight status in relation to height (weight/height2) with weight in kilograms and height in meters. Population exposure to fine particule PM2.5 provide an estimate of the population-weighted average of PM2.5 concentration. Respiratory system diseases mortality rate is the number of deaths from diseases of the respiratory system (group J00-J99 of the International Classification of Deseases), for 100 000 inhabitants. Circulatory system diseases mortality rate rate is the number of deaths from diseases of the circulatory system (group I00-I99) for 100 000 inhabitants. PM2.5 air pollution indicators are computed using geospatial data from the Global Burden of Disease (GBD) 2019 project. Respiratory and circulatory related mortality data are collected from Eurostat (reg_hlth) for EU regions and via delegates of the OECD Working Party on Territorial Indicators (WPTI), as well as from national statistical offices' websites. Definition of regions Regions are subnational units below national boundaries. OECD countries have two regional levels: large regions (territorial level 2 or TL2) and small regions (territorial level 3 or TL3). For more information, see the OECD Territorial grid (pdf) and the OECD Territorial Correspondence Table (xlsx). Use of data on small regions When socio-demographic data are analysed along with economic data using the TL3 level, it is advisable to aggregate data at the metropolitan region level when several TL3 regions are associated to the same metropolitan region. Metropolitan regions combine TL3 regions when 50% or more of the regional population live in a functionnal urban areas above 250 000 inhabitants. This approach corrects the distortions created by commuting, see the list of OECD metropolitan regions (xlsx) and the EU methodology (link).
